Output 3418698facaf00109cc1d5373288ce6ded59b1076a7d71cad46dd18d5d79ff4f:0

value
811410
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95f8c20bf98deb62a89f48fba2e31ac82e315dbe OP_EQUALVERIFY OP_CHECKSIG
address
1EfygbHxssXQgAUZRJzFBNMX5JDTEqgMng
transaction
3418698facaf00109cc1d5373288ce6ded59b1076a7d71cad46dd18d5d79ff4f
confirmations
310868
spent
true